- study aspects of behaviour in wild, domestic and captive animals - understand the ‘how’ and ‘why’ of natural behaviour: how current and past environments and ecology influence behaviour, how behaviour is shaped by underlying gene-environment interactions, and why we see variation among individuals, species and species groups - experience extensive fieldwork in the uk and international locations - the programme highlights the value of studying animals in their natural habitats - to learn more about modules, assessment methods, facilities and our staff research expertise please visit our course page.
